This is a drawing of a jazz band in full swing. The image features five musicians playing different instruments - clarinet, trumpet, drum, double bass, and trombone. The figures are drawn with exaggerated expressions and poses. The background is dark and swirling, with strong lines and contrasts accentuating the movement and intensity of the performance. The black and white tones add a classic quality to the depiction of the musicians.
